Introduction
Jomdom Capsule is a prescription medicine used to treat gastroesophageal reflux disease (Acid reflux) and indigestion by relieving the symptoms such as heartburn, stomach pain, or irritation. It also neutralizes the acid in the stomach and promotes easy passage of gas to reduce stomach discomfort.
Directions for Use
Take this medicine in the dose and duration as advised by your doctor. Jomdom Capsule is to be taken empty stomach.
How it works
Jomdom Capsule is a combination of two medicines: Domperidone and Esomeprazole..Domperidone is a prokinetic which works on the upper digestive tract to increase the movement of the stomach and intestines allowing the food to move more easily through the stomach..Esomeprazole is a proton pump inhibitor (PPI) which works by reducing the amount of acid in the stomach which helps in the relief of acid-related indigestion and heartburn.
Quick Tips
You have been prescribed Jomdom Capsule for the treatment of acidity and heartburn. Take it one hour before the meal preferably in the morning. It is a well-tolerated medicine and provides relief for a long time. Inform your doctor if you get watery diarrhea fever or stomach pain that does not go away. Inform your doctor if you do not feel better after taking it for 14 days as you may be suffering from some other problem that needs attention. Long-term use can cause weak bones and deficiency of minerals such as magnesium. Take adequate dietary intake of calcium and magnesium or their supplements as prescribed by your doctor.

What is the best time to take Jomdom Capsule?
It is recommended to take Jomdom Capsule before the first meal of the day or on an empty stomach.
Can the use of Jomdom Capsule cause abnormal heartbeat?
Yes, the use of Jomdom Capsule may increase the risk of irregular heartbeat (serious arrhythmias). This is a serious side effect, but the chance of it occurring is very low. The risk may be slightly higher in patients over 60 years of age.
